1. AI at the Heart of Apple’s Ecosystem

Apple’s integration of AI technologies goes beyond surface-level features; it’s deeply embedded in every aspect of its ecosystem. The company has focused on creating seamless user experiences across its devices by integrating machine learning (ML) and AI algorithms in ways that often go unnoticed but dramatically enhance performance and usability.
a) Siri: The AI-Powered Assistant
Introduced in 2011, Siri was one of the earliest mainstream AI-powered voice assistants. Though Siri faced initial criticism for its limitations, it has since evolved into a sophisticated AI tool thanks to advancements in natural language processing (NLP) and machine learning. Today, Siri understands and responds to complex user queries, manages tasks like setting reminders, and integrates with third-party apps to offer a more cohesive experience across Apple devices.
Apple continues to refine Siri’s intelligence using on-device AI, allowing it to provide more personalized recommendations, faster responses, and better understanding of user intent—all while prioritizing privacy.
b) Machine Learning Across Devices
One of Apple’s biggest AI contributions is its Core ML framework, which allows developers to build machine learning capabilities directly into apps for iOS, macOS, watchOS, and tvOS. Core ML powers various features, such as image recognition, speech processing, and augmented reality (AR), making everyday experiences more efficient. For example, iPhone users benefit from AI in Face ID for secure authentication, enhanced photo organization in the Photos app, and predictive text in the keyboard.
c) Neural Engine: Apple Silicon’s AI Boost
With the introduction of Apple Silicon, starting with the M1 chip, AI became an even bigger focus. The Neural Engine in Apple’s chips, specifically designed to handle AI and machine learning tasks, offers immense computing power for processes like image processing, video editing, and real-time translation. Whether it’s editing a 4K video in Final Cut Pro or improving the efficiency of health monitoring apps, the Neural Engine accelerates tasks that would otherwise require immense processing power and time.
2. Health and AI: Apple’s Game-Changer
Perhaps one of Apple’s most impactful AI contributions lies in healthcare. With the Apple Watch, Apple is using AI to transform health monitoring and diagnostics. The Apple Watch’s health sensors track vital data such as heart rate, blood oxygen levels, and irregular heart rhythms, with AI algorithms analyzing this data to offer early warnings about potential health issues.
AI-driven features like fall detection, ECG (electrocardiogram) readings, and the ability to monitor trends in fitness and sleep patterns have not only improved everyday health monitoring but also saved lives by alerting users and medical professionals to anomalies. As Apple continues to develop its health platform, the integration of AI for predictive and personalized healthcare services will play an even greater role.
3. Privacy-Centric AI: Apple’s Unique Approach

Unlike many other tech giants, Apple takes a strong stance on privacy, which extends to its AI initiatives. Apple’s philosophy of privacy-first AI is evident in how it handles data—especially compared to companies like Google or Facebook, which rely on large-scale data collection for ad-targeting purposes. Apple ensures that most AI processing, like Face ID or personalized recommendations in Siri, happens directly on the device rather than in the cloud. This approach minimizes the need to collect or store user data, creating a safer environment for users while still delivering advanced AI-powered services.
Apple’s emphasis on on-device AI aligns with its efforts to comply with strict privacy regulations like the European Union’s General Data Protection Regulation (GDPR). As AI becomes more deeply ingrained in every aspect of the digital experience, Apple’s commitment to privacy could set a new standard for the industry.
4. AI in Augmented Reality (AR) and Beyond
Apple has made significant strides in AI-powered augmented reality. Since launching ARKit in 2017, developers have created immersive AR apps for iPhones and iPads, using AI to enable real-time recognition and interaction with real-world environments. Looking ahead, Apple’s anticipated AR glasses could integrate seamlessly with the Apple ecosystem, using AI to deliver contextual information and interaction. This fusion of AR, AI, and Apple hardware could revolutionize industries like education, gaming, retail, and design.
